Understanding the Causes of a Sewer Backup

Before we can effectively tackle a sewer backup, it’s crucial to understand what might be causing it. Several issues can lead to sewage backing up into your sinks, tubs, toilets, or even your basement. Recognizing these common culprits can help you identify a problem early, though professional diagnosis is always recommended.

  • Severe Clogs: This is perhaps the most common reason. A buildup of grease, hair, food particles, “flushable” wipes, or other foreign objects can create a significant blockage in your main sewer line. Over time, these blockages grow, restricting flow until wastewater has nowhere to go but back up into your home.
  • Tree Root Intrusion: Trees are magnificent, but their roots are relentless. They naturally seek out moisture and nutrients, and often find them in the tiny cracks and joints of your sewer pipes. Once inside, roots can proliferate, forming dense networks that trap debris and cause severe blockages, leading to a frustrating sewer backup. This is a common issue we address in older neighborhoods throughout Delaware County, from Drexel Hill to Swarthmore.
  • Broken, Collapsed, or Cracked Pipes: Older pipes, especially those made of clay or cast iron, are susceptible to corrosion, shifting soil, ground movement, or even heavy vehicle traffic above. These issues can cause pipes to crack, collapse, or become misaligned, creating obstacles for wastewater flow and structural weaknesses that lead to backups.
  • Sagging (Bellied) Pipes: A section of your sewer line can sink due to unstable soil conditions or improper installation. This creates a “belly” in the pipe where water and waste can collect, leading to persistent clogs and eventual backups.
  • Municipal Sewer System Problems: While less common for the individual homeowner, sometimes the problem isn’t with your private sewer line but with the municipal sewer system itself. Heavy rains can overwhelm public sewers, or a blockage in the main city line could cause a backup that affects multiple properties, including yours.

Step 1: Accurate Diagnosis with Camera Inspection

The first and most crucial step in any effective sewer backup repair is accurately diagnosing the problem. We utilize state-of-the-art sewer camera inspection technology. A high-resolution camera is snaked into your sewer line, providing us with a live, detailed view of the pipe’s interior. This allows our experienced technicians to pinpoint the exact location and nature of the blockage or damage – whether it’s a massive root intrusion in Lansdowne, a collapsed section in Wallingford, or a severe grease clog in Ridley Park. This visual evidence eliminates guesswork, ensuring we recommend the most appropriate and effective solution.

Step 2: Clearing the Way with Hydro Jetting

Often, before a repair can even begin, the immediate blockage causing the backup needs to be cleared. For this, we employ powerful hydro jetting. This process uses high-pressure water streams to blast away even the most stubborn clogs, grease buildup, mineral deposits, and tree roots from your pipes. Hydro jetting not only clears the blockage but also cleans the entire interior of the pipe, restoring it to near-original diameter and preparing it for further inspection or trenchless repair methods if necessary. Step 3: Implementing Trenchless Sewer Repair Solutions

Once the line is clear and the damage is precisely located, we can proceed with our advanced trenchless repair methods. These techniques are designed to fix your sewer line without the extensive, destructive excavation typically associated with traditional sewer line replacements.

Pipe Lining (Cured-In-Place Pipe – CIPP)

For pipes with cracks, minor breaks, or extensive root damage, pipe lining is an excellent trenchless solution. This method involves inserting a flexible, resin-saturated liner into the existing damaged pipe. The liner is then inflated and allowed to cure, creating a new, seamless, and durable pipe within the old one. This new pipe is stronger than many traditional materials, resistant to corrosion and root intrusion, and significantly extends the life of your sewer system. Pipe Bursting

When your sewer pipe is severely collapsed, heavily damaged, or needs to be upsized, pipe bursting is our go-to trenchless method. This process involves pulling a new pipe through the old, damaged one. A conical bursting head is attached to the new pipe, which fragments the old pipe outwards as the new pipe is pulled through its path. This method allows us to replace an entire section of your sewer line with a brand-new, durable pipe (usually HDPE) without digging a continuous trench.
